Other properties have more complex value types for instance, the Folder Usage property accepts multiple values, and the Impact property is an ordered list. Some are simple for example, the Personal Use property can be only Yes or No, and the Retention Start Date property accepts only date/time values. Each classification property has a predefined set of possible values types. There are eight types of classification properties in Windows Server 2016, including yes/no, date/time and multiple-choice list. There’s also a Windows PowerShell classifier module that lets system administrators access the API and classify files using any properties they like, without needing to code in C# or C++. In addition, applications can use the FCI API to analyze files and enable users to manually classify documents from within the applications in which they are created. ![]() ![]() If you classify your organization’s Microsoft Office templates, users can create documents with the necessary metadata already in place. Users can also manually classify files using the Classification tab that Windows Server 2012 and Windows 8 add to Windows Explorer. FCI uses Windows Search to crawl your file servers and automatically classify the files based on the classification properties and rules you set up. The easiest way to classify files with FCI is to use its built-in engine.
